Background & History of The Name Kylah
Kylah is a modern feminine name primarily used in the United States, often considered a variant of Kayla or a creative blend inspired by Hebrew origins. The name carries the meaning of being crowned or victorious, symbolizing success and honor. It gained popularity in recent decades as parents sought fresh and appealing names with a strong yet elegant sound. Notable bearers of the name Kylah are mostly found in contemporary culture, including young artists and athletes, contributing to its rising recognition and appeal.
